Oulton BSB: Byrne ‘surprised’ with pole position

Rapid Solicitors Kawasaki’s Shane Byrne is still in shock after he nabbed pole from Milwaukee Yamaha’s Josh Brookes during the MCE British Superbike qualifying session at Oulton Park.

A 1’35.463 was enough to place the triple-champ on the number one spot on the grid and was a half a tenth quicker than the Australian. But Byrne was still under lap record pace, and didn’t go faster than the time set by Brookes in FP3 today.

“I thought I was in P2, I didn’t realise I was on pole till I got back  to the pits. All I wanted was the front row and I thought that I had done enough for that – and I did,” said Byrne at the circuit.

“But we were all a bit surprised to be honest – but happy. The team have work to do on the bike and we are still hoping to improve but we have been chipping away this weekend."
